How Automation Is Transforming Food-Grade Warehousing Operations
In food-grade warehousing, precision isn’t a luxury; it’s the baseline. Every pallet, every pick, every degree of temperature matters. And as demands for food safety, speed, and transparency rise, traditional manual systems are buckling under pressure.
That’s where automation comes in.
From robotic arms to intelligent software, automation is transforming how food is stored, moved, and monitored. It’s not about replacing workers. It’s about removing the bottlenecks that keep warehouses from reaching their potential.
Raising the Bar on Safety and Efficiency
Automation helps reduce the risk of contamination by limiting human contact with sensitive products. Systems like Automated Storage and Retrieval (ASRS) and voice-directed picking improve consistency and speed. For perishable goods, this precision can mean the difference between safe and spoiled.
Temperature sensors and real-time tracking also ensure that nothing slips through the cracks by continuously logging conditions and triggering alerts if things veer off course.
Shrinking Waste, Expanding Capacity
Automated warehouses utilize vertical space more efficiently, often increasing capacity without requiring additional square footage. And with energy-intensive cold storage, that matters. The more efficient the footprint, the less you spend on keeping things cold.
At the same time, tools like AGVs (Automated Guided Vehicles) and smart conveyors can move inventory faster and with fewer errors. That leads to fewer damaged goods, better order accuracy, and reduced labor strain.
